    I wanted to know if any of you have had trouble with the actual lock on the ap cages?
    Today I feed and my lock fell apart some how and fell from the key or something. I noticed this when I tried to put the lock back on the cage. The actual lock stays in place but you can pull it out with your fingers not using the key!.

    What can I do in the mean time to make sure my cage stays locked, until I can get a replacement lock mechanism from Ali? Any help is appreciated.

    Never had problems with my AP locks. Now the LED lights....I've had to replace all of them so far except my T25 ones lol.

    As for a makeshift lock, you can use a coat hanger and bend it into a modified "S" shape to keep the 2 doors from opening. Can also just go to the hardware store and buy some dowel rod skinny enough to sit in the tracks and then cut them to size.
